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age issues early on can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ent more extensive damage. Look out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show moisture buildup in your commercial property. Don’t ignore these smells, they can be a sign of more significant issues.

Warped or Discolored Flooring

Changes in flooring color or texture can show water damage. Addressing this issue quickly can pr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Water Stains or Mineral Deposits

Visible water stains or mineral deposits on walls, ceilings, or furniture can be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ify and address these issues before they become major problems.

Leaks or Water Spots

Leaks or water spots on ceilings, walls, or floors can show a more significant issue. Don’t ignore these signs, our team can help you identify and address the problem before it’s too late.

Unusual Sounds or Puddles

Unusual sounds or puddles in your commercial property can be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ify and address the issue quickly and efficiently.

Commercial Water Damage Restoration Cost in Kent, WA

The cost of Commercial Water Damage Restoration in Kent, WA, varies dep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team provides free estimates and works closely with your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process. Here’s a breakdown of the typical costs associated with each step of the process: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and planning $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Water removal and drying $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Disinfection and d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Severity of damage, type of equipment needed
Reconstruction and repair $2,000 – $10,000 Scope of project, materials needed

Keep in mind that these estimates are subject to change based on the specifics of your situation. Our team will work with you to develop a personalized plan and provide a free estimate for the work.

How do I prevent water damage in my commercial property?

Preventing water damage in your commercial property needs regular maintenance and inspections. Check your roof, gutters, and pipes regularly for signs of damage or wear. Make sure to address any issues quickly to prevent more extensive damage.
